When I was young I did the things
That Daddy did.
Not everyone believed in me,
But Daddy did.
In time I came to understand
My life had purpose and a plan,
And I could grow to be a man
‘Cause Daddy did.
No one ever loved me more
Than Daddy did.
No one taught me right from wrong
Like Daddy did.
In time I came to comprehend
That every person has to die.
My grief extended to the sky
When Daddy did.
Two little boys around me run—
I’m Daddy now.
And they look up to me ‘cause I’m
Their Daddy now.
I hope they’ll come to understand
They have a purpose and a plan,
And they can grow to be a man
‘Cause Daddy did.
Written in memory of my Dad
